Successive home defeats piled the pressure on Albert Riera at Eintracht Frankfurt as the young coach is also dealing with off-the-pitch issues that he vehemently denied in a press conference. Jonathan Burkardt returned to the starting lineup, but Eintracht Frankfurt suffered a narrow defeat at Deutsche Bank Park to Hamburger SV.
“We're disappointed – both with the result and the performance,” said the Spaniard after the game. “It simply wasn't good enough. We lacked energy in the first half. In the second half, we shouldn't have stopped pushing forward, even when we were leading.
“We had chances to win the game, but we weren't efficient enough. We have to do better, and we have to play much better. We need the fans, and I completely agree with their reaction. But we stand together. Together we are stronger, and we will fight for the (remaining) six points.”
Midfielder Can Uzun also addressed the reaction of the fans after the final whistle. “I completely understand the fans. They come to the stadium wanting to see a good game. Unfortunately, they see a performance like this from us. It's not good enough. We have to do more. We, players, aren't delivering the performance we're capable of. That's why we're not winning,” said the player who scored the first goal of the match.
Freiburg can now go three points ahead of Riera’s men if they beat Wolfsburg tomorrow. Eintracht Frankfurt’s remaining games are against Borussia Dortmund and VfB Stuttgart.
